5 Ways To Improve Productivity In An Engineering Company

Posted on July 4, 2022 by The Times USA News

The productivity of an engineering company is dependent on the tools that the management and staff use. A lot of engineering companies struggle when it comes to improving the productivity of their companies. This article highlights five ways engineering companies can improve productivity.

  • Trust and openness among employees
  • Making confidential poll about staff contentment
  • Utilize open discussions
  • Employ activities aimed at strengthening teams
  • Utilize the appropriate equipment

Trust and openness among employees

The ability to respect one another is essential to the success of any interaction. This has also been shown to be the case in the corporate world. In fact, studies have shown that open communication between executives and workers is the single most significant contributor to job productivity. Include your technical staff in the decision-making process for matters that bear strongly on their day-to-day work. If you show true concern for the individuals of your engineering team, you will likely discover that your engineering staff is far more effective in a short period of time.

Making confidential poll about staff contentment

You may get quantifiable information to continually monitor the level of contentment felt by workers across a variety of aspects. This can be done by conducting a poll. This will provide you with helpful information into the areas in which there is room for development. You may also gain suggestions on how these aspects might be built upon by using questionnaires to investigate them. Workers are able to answer questions freely and offer insightful feedback when they are certain that their responses will not be linked to them in any way, thanks to the anonymity provided by the poll.

Utilize open discussion

A WIFI is used by many firms to ensure that there is a smooth flow of information inside the company. Some businesses choose to utilize Zoom, while others prefer a closed group on Facebook. Encourage staff to make suggestions for innovative goods and procedures, irrespective of the approach that you are using to solve the problem. Workers who believe their opinions and contributions are being heard and respected are more likely to report high levels of job satisfaction.

Employ activities aimed at strengthening teams

According to research, there is a one-to-one relationship between the level of happiness experienced by individuals and the degree to which their fellow colleagues get along. It is energy and commitment that is well worth it when it comes to creating a culture of collaboration and investment in group activities.

Utilize the Appropriate Equipment

Most engineering workers find that having to work with archaic technology and devices is frustrating. They have the potential to cause activities to take far more than the required time and reduce overall productivity. This does not imply that you are required to immediately update all of your hardware to the most recent and cutting-edge solutions all at once. Something as simple as trying to add a connection between Siemens Polarion and Confluence can do the trick.

Improving the productivity of an engineering company is never easy. However, when the right techniques are followed, it ceases to be a problem.
